{"count":1,"message":"Results returned successfully","results":[{"odiNumber":11743992,"manufacturer":"Hyundai Motor America","crash":false,"fire":false,"numberOfInjuries":0,"numberOfDeaths":0,"dateOfIncident":"05/18/2026","dateComplaintFiled":"06/14/2026","vin":"5NPEF4JA8LH","components":"ENGINE","summary":"My 2020 Hyundai Sonata 2.5L is experiencing excessive engine oil consumption. At approximately 88,063 miles, Great Lakes Hyundai documented that the engine oil level was 1.30 quarts below full after an oil-consumption check. The dealer topped off the oil, submitted photos and a prior-authorization/goodwill request to Hyundai, and Hyundai declined assistance. The dealer recommended combustion chamber cleaning with an estimate of $979.76.  I am concerned that this excessive oil consumption could lead to sudden engine damage, loss of power, stalling, or engine failure if the oil level drops between checks. The vehicle is only a 2020 model year, and this level of oil consumption appears abnormal. I am also concerned about possible emissions/catalytic converter damage from oil burning.","products":[{"type":"Vehicle","productYear":"2020","productMake":"HYUNDAI","productModel":"SONATA","manufacturer":"Hyundai Motor America"}]}]}
